The Chinese word 按部就班 is a four-character idiom formed by combining individual characters with specific meanings: 按 means "according to", 部 means "section", 就 means "to take up", and 班 means "order". Historically derived from a Jin Dynasty poem about literary composition, it literally translates to "follow the sections and take up the order", conveying through this structure the idea of proceeding systematically step-by-step according to a established sequence or plan.
